Median home value - Philadelphia Metro Area, PA is 59% above Terre Haute Metro Area, IN and 1% below the national average. Median household income - Philadelphia Metro Area, PA is 35% above Terre Haute Metro Area, IN and 11% above the national average.

Crime Index - Terre Haute Metro Area, IN has crime index above the national average and Philadelphia Metro Area, PA has crime index below the national average.
Crime Index represents the risk of crime occurring in a area and is measured against national index of 100. If the Crime Index of an area is above 100 the crime in that area is relatively higher when compared to US. If the Crime Index of an area is below 100 the crime in that area is lower when compared to US.
